## Welcome to ScrubJay

Hey! ScrubJay is our EXIF-scrubbing pipeline — every image uploaded through the Plumridge apps passes through it before hitting storage. Your job as a contractor will mostly touch the scrub rules in `rules/` (which tags to strip, which to normalize). Local setup: copy `env.sample` to `.env`, set SCRUBJAY_WORKDIR to somewhere with a few GB free, and leave SCRUBJAY_STRICT=1 on unless debugging. The pipeline fetches test fixtures from our asset vault, which needs a credential — that's the line right after this.

vault entry, kafog-yahop: COURIER_KEY8=0faa53ae

// --- Petrel Events: schema registry client setup ---
// Heads up: every event we publish has to be validated against the
// Petrel schema registry before it hits the bus, or the broker will
// bounce it with a cryptic 422. The client below handles fetching and
// caching schemas for you, so don't roll your own. It needs an auth
// key for the registry service, which goes right here:

API key for tajop-tagaf: zpat15_wFKIn9d85K88goH

Heads up: the Pinewhistle clinic reminder job sometimes stalls in CI when the fake-patient fixture database takes too long to seed. Don't panic — just rerun the seed step before the reminder stage. If it fails twice, ping the Oakrun platform channel. When escalating, always attach the build token shown below.

pipeline stamp: htk9_ce63042d9

# Cold Storage Archival — notes for the weekly eng sync (Team Permafrost)
# This config governs the nightly sweep that moves buckets untouched for 180+
# days from the Tarnwell hot tier into Glacierpoint cold storage. Please review
# ARCHIVE_BATCH_SIZE carefully before changing it; batches over 500 objects
# have caused manifest timeouts twice this quarter. Restores must go through
# the ops queue, never directly. The sweep job authenticates to the
# Glacierpoint API with the key declared on the next line.

secret setting of kagug-tajep: COURIER_KEY8=e81a8675

## Build Provenance: Catalog Cache Invalidation

Quick note for the security review of Brindlecart's product catalog. Cache entries are keyed off the catalog snapshot digest, so any upstream edit — price, SKU, imagery — forces a full key rotation rather than a partial purge. No stale reads survive a publish. To audit a specific invalidation wave, start from the trace token recorded below.

session token of tajog-fahaf = htk21_4ae55819f45410afcb307